Places to Visit from your Kendal Calling Accommodation

When you book accommodation near Kendal Calling, you’ll find yourself perfectly placed to explore some of Cumbria’s most scenic towns and villages... all just a short drive from the festival site.

One place that’s well worth a visit is Penrith, found around a 35-minute drive from most Kendal Calling accommodation. Once a vital stronghold in the region, this historic market town is known for its cobbled streets, castle ruins and beautiful local architecture. While you’re here, take a wander through the town centre to discover a variety of independent shops, charming cafés and traditional pubs. For a spot of history, Penrith Castle and the nearby ruins of Brougham Castle are both excellent choices.

Another brilliant place to explore is Pooley Bridge, located around 30 minutes away by car. Set on the northern tip of Ullswater, this picturesque village is a fantastic spot for lakeside walks and boat rides. From here, you can hop aboard one of the popular Ullswater Steamers for a cruise across the lake or set off on foot to tackle scenic walking routes like the trail up to Aira Force waterfall. The village itself is home to a handful of cosy pubs, gift shops and tearooms... ideal for a relaxing afternoon out.
